Average First-Line Supervisors of Production and Operating Workers Salary in Bridgeport-Stamford-Danbury, CT

First-Line Supervisors of Production and Operating Workers in the Bridgeport-Stamford-Danbury, CT area command an impressive average annual salary of $85,010. This figure significantly surpasses the national average of $74,160, indicating a premium for these essential roles within the local economy. The higher compensation reflects the specific demands and economic drivers present in this Connecticut region.

How much does a First-Line Supervisors of Production and Operating Workers make in Bridgeport-Stamford-Danbury, CT?

The median annual salary for a First-Line Supervisors of Production and Operating Workers in Bridgeport-Stamford-Danbury, CT is $85,010. This typically ranges from $50,720 for entry-level positions to $118,500 for top-level roles.

How does the salary compare to the national average?

The average salary for this role in Bridgeport-Stamford-Danbury, CT is 14.6% higher than the national median of $74,160.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 1,520 employees in the Bridgeport-Stamford-Danbury, CT area with a job density of 3.772 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
